Just confused while reading the stickied FAQs on clownfish, where the PDF Anemone FAQ states that the only 2 Anemones that True Perculas prefer are Heteractis magnifica (ritteri anemone) or Stichodactyla gigantea. However, it also states that those are the only anemones that are classified as the "Most Difficult." Does this mean that True Perculas should probably not be had by novice aquarists? I have never heard of True Percula's being hard to keep.
I have heard that the E. quadricolor (bubble anemone) and S. haddoni (saddle anemone) are also good choices for True Perculas. Is this true?
